WHAT IS MYOFUNCTIONAL & SPEECH THERAPY?
Orofacial Myofunctional Therapy works to correct any maladaptive behaviors affecting chewing, swallowing, and breathing caused by weaknesses and/or imbalances of the orofacial muscles. Its goals are: nasal breathing, accurate tongue resting posture, efficient swallowing function, and efficient speech.
Speech therapy is the broad term for therapy treating disorders in fluency, speech production, language, voice, resonance, feeding/swallowing, cognition, and auditory rehabilitation/habilitation.
